pub enum Node {
Element(NodeElement),
Attribute(NodeAttribute),
Text(NodeText),
Comment(NodeComment),
Doctype(NodeDoctype),
Block(NodeBlock),
Fragment(NodeFragment),
}
Expand description
Node in the tree.
Variants
Element(NodeElement)
Attribute(NodeAttribute)
Text(NodeText)
Comment(NodeComment)
Doctype(NodeDoctype)
Block(NodeBlock)
Fragment(NodeFragment)
Implementations
Trait Implementations
Auto Trait Implementations
impl RefUnwindSafe for Node
impl !Send for Node
impl !Sync for Node
impl Unpin for Node
impl UnwindSafe for Node
Blanket Implementations
sourceimpl<T> BorrowMut<T> for Twhere
T: ?Sized,
impl<T> BorrowMut<T> for Twhere
T: ?Sized,
const: unstable · sourcefn borrow_mut(&mut self) -> &mut T
fn borrow_mut(&mut self) -> &mut T
Mutably borrows from an owned value. Read more